Output a3dbda95d3ee42948905bb06230ac45ec3f97d2986366aa61e90c4b953d2c746:1

value
18163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fabc9e779faceef8e90a08acbfc74f5ee679ffe OP_EQUAL
address
3Ld5bLfuPkd4BpBT49QxjdoGXWAhE5ivPM
transaction
a3dbda95d3ee42948905bb06230ac45ec3f97d2986366aa61e90c4b953d2c746
confirmations
117590
spent
true